ACM Learning Center
August 29, 2017
to view image click on
Welcome to the ACM Learning Center Bulletin

Welcome to the August 2017 ACM Learning Center Bulletin, keeping you current on the many online learning tools ACM offers to help extend our members' skills and knowledge. To suggest addition of books, courses, future Webinar speakers and topics, or just offer feedback, leave a note in the Learning Center Suggestion Box

ACM Learning Center

TOP STORIES

•  Register Now: "Open Collaboration, the Eclipse Way," with Mike Milinkovich on September 7

•  Available on Demand: "A.I., People, and the Open World," with Eric Horvitz

•  Available on Demand: "Monadic Programming for the Web Using React and RxJS," with Pat Sissons

•  Available on Demand: "Using Machine Learning to Study Neural Representations of Language Meaning," with Tom Mitchell

LEARNING CENTER: Books, Courses, Videos

•  Featured Skillsoft Course: CISSP: Communication & Network Security Design

•  New Skillsoft Books: August 2017

•  New Skillsoft Videos: August 2017

•  Featured Safari Title: OpenStack Cloud Application Development

•  Featured ScienceDirect Title: Coding for Penetration Testers

•  ACM Interview: Juergen Schmidhuber

NEWS/ANNOUNCEMENTS

•  Volunteer Your Computing Skills for a Social Good with ACM and SocialCoder

IN THE SPOTLIGHT

Register Now: "Open Collaboration, the Eclipse Way," with Mike Milinkovich on September 7
Register now for the next ACM Learning Webinar, "Open Collaboration, the Eclipse Way," presented live on Thursday, Steptember 7 at 12 PM ET by Mike Milinkovich, Executive Director of the Eclipse Foundation. Will Traz, Past Chair of ACM SIGSOFT, moderates the questions and answers session following the talk. Leave your questions for the Q&A and comments now, during, and after the talk on ACM's Discourse Page. You can view our entire archive of past ACM Learning Webinars on demand at http://webinar.acm.org/.

Available on Demand: "A.I., People, and the Open World," with Eric Horvitz
If you missed it live, check out "A.I., People, and the Open World," presented by Eric Horvitz, Technical Fellow and Director of Microsoft Research Labs; ACM Fellow. Stephen Ibaraki, Co-Chair of the ACM Practitioners Board, moderated a questions and answers session following the talk. Continue the discussion on ACM's Discourse Page. You can view our entire archive of past ACM Learning Webinars on demand at http://webinar.acm.org/.

Available on Demand: "Monadic Programming for the Web Using React and RxJS," with Pat Sissons
If you missed it live, check out "Monadic Programming for the Web Using React and RxJS," presented by Pat Sissons, Senior Software Developer at Marine Learning Systems. Erik Meijer, Founder and CEO at Applied Duality and member of the ACM Queue Editorial Board, moderated the questions and answers session following the talk. Leave your questions for the Q&A and comments now, during, and after the talk on ACM's Discourse Page. You can view our entire archive of past ACM Learning Webinars on demand at http://webinar.acm.org/.

Available on Demand: "Using Machine Learning to Study Neural Representations of Language Meaning," with Tom Mitchell
If you missed it live, check out "Using Machine Learning to Study Neural Representations of Language Meaning," presented by Tom Mitchell, Professor at Carnegie Mellon University. Will Tracz, Lockheed Martin Fellow Emeritus and Former Chair of ACM SIGSOFT, led the questions and answers session following the talk. Continue the discussion on ACM's Discourse Page. You can view our entire archive of past ACM Learning Webinars on demand at http://webinar.acm.org/.

Learning Center: Books, Courses, Videos

Featured Skillsoft Course: CISSP: Communication & Network Security Design
This month's featured Skillsoft course is CISSP: Communication & Network Security Design. Securing network communications is a key activity in managing the security of any IT system, and the network is a common and potent vector for attack. In this course, you'll learn about the design and components of network systems, how to implement secure systems, and how to mitigate common attacks.

To access this and more than 1,750 Skillsoft Learning Collections courses, visit the ACM Learning Center, click on the Skillsoft Learning in the top right corner, log in with your member credentials, and click on Skillsoft Learning again. To jump directly to particular subject areas, visit the Skillsoft Learning Collections page. For more on the features in Skillport 8, see our Skillsoft FAQ/Support page.

New Skillsoft Books: August 2017
New books covering the latest IT skills and technologies are always being added to the ACM Skillsoft Learning Collections. Here are some of the notable titles recently added to our library:

  • Advances in GPU Research and Practice
  • Algorithms for Dummies
  • Android: Pocket Primer
  • API Management: An Architect's Guide to Developing and Managing APIs for Your Organization
  • Application Performance Management (APM) in the Digital Enterprise: Managing Applications for Cloud, Mobile, IoT and eBusiness
  • Build Mobile Apps with Ionic 2 and Firebase: Fu Cheng
  • C Programming: A Self-Teaching Introduction
  • C# Programming in Easy Steps
  • Chatbots for eCommerce: Learn How to Build a Virtual Shopping Assistant
  • Cloud Computing: A Self-Teaching Introduction
  • CompTIA A+ Practice Tests: Exam 220-901 and Exam 220-902
  • Computer Vision in Vehicle Technology: Land, Sea, and Air
  • Essential Docker for ASP.NET Core MVC
  • Exploring Swift Playgrounds: The Fastest and Most Effective Way to Learn to Code and to Teach Others to Use Your Code
  • Functional Programming in R: Advanced Statistical Programming for Data Science, Analysis and Finance
  • Imaginarium: The Process Behind the Pictures
  • InDesign in Easy Steps: Covers Versions CS3, CS4, and CS5
  • IoT Solutions in Microsoft's Azure IoT Suite: Data Acquisition and Analysis in the Real World
  • iPhone & Apple Watch for Health & Fitness in Easy Steps
  • Java 9 Revealed: For Early Adoption and Migration
  • Learn ASP.NET Core MVC: Be Ready Next Week Using Visual Studio 2017
  • OCA Java SE 8 Programmer I Exam Guide (Exams 1Z0-808)
  • Operating Systems: An Introduction
  • Oracle Application Express: Build Powerful Data-Centric Web Apps with APEX
  • Oracle Database 12c Release 2 In-Memory: Tips and Techniques for Maximum Performance
  • Oracle SQL Tuning with Oracle SQLTXPLAIN: Oracle Database 12c Edition, Second Edition
  • Photoshop Elements 15 Tips, Tricks & Shortcuts in Easy Steps
  • Practical GameMaker: Studio Language Projects
  • Programming Essentials Using Java: A Game Application Approach
  • Python 3: Pocket Primer
  • Quantum Machine Learning: What Quantum Computing Means to Data Mining
  • Raspberry Pi Image Processing Programming: Develop Real-Life Examples with Python, Pillow, and SciPy
  • Research Methods for Cyber Security
  • Spring Boot Messaging: Messaging APIs for Enterprise and Integration Solutions
  • Spring Boot: How to Get Started and Build a Microservice
  • The Agile Enterprise: Building and Running Agile Organizations
  • The Dramatic Portrait: The Art of Crafting Light and Shadow
  • The Film Photography Handbook: Rediscovering Photography in 35mm, Medium, and Large Format
  • The Indispensable Guide to Lightroom CC: Managing, Editing, and Sharing Your Photos
  • The Metadata Manual: A Practical Workbook
  • The Photographer's Guide to Drones
  • The Photographer's Guide to Posing: Techniques to Flatter Everyone
  • The Soul of the Camera: The Photographer's Place in Picture-Making
  • Website Hosting and Migration with Amazon Web Services: A Practical Guide to Moving Your Website to AWS
  • Xamarin Continuous Integration and Delivery: Team Services, Test Cloud, and HockeyApp

To access this and more than 4,800 Skillsoft Learning Collections eBooks, visit the ACM Learning Center, log in with your member credentials, and click on Skillsoft Learning in the top right corner. To jump directly to particular subject areas, visit the Skillsoft Learning Collections page.

New Skillsoft Short Videos: August 2017
Did you know that ACM members have access to thousands of IT and productivity videos from Skillsoft? Covering a variety of today's hottest topics, these videos offer "on-the-job" support and "just-in-time" solutions for busy practitioners. Recently, Skillsoft added significant video content in the following knowledge areas:

  • Application Performance Engineering
  • AWS Essentials
  • CISM
  • Developing Microsoft Azure Solutions
  • HTML5, JavaScript, and CSS3
  • IBM WebSphere Commerce
  • JS Frameworks and Libraries
  • MongoDB
  • Office 365
  • PowerShell Essentials
  • Securing Windows Server 2016
  • Security+
  • System Center

See learning.acm.org/books/skillsoft_video.cfm for more information on short videos.

Featured Safari Title: OpenStack Cloud Application Development
OpenStack Cloud Application Development is a fast-paced, professional book for OpenStack developers, delivering comprehensive guidance without wasting time on development fundamentals. Written by experts in the OpenStack community from Infoblox, Gigaspaces, GoDaddy, and Comcast, this book shows you how to work effectively and efficiently within the OpenStack platform to develop large, scalable applications without worrying about underlying hardware. Follow along with an OpenStack build that illustrates how and where each technology comes into play, as you learn expert tips and best practices that make your product stronger. Coverage includes OpenStack service primitives, networking within the OpenStack Ecosystem, deployment of Virtualized Network Functions for Enterprises, containers, data protection, and much more.

To access this and more than 40,000 award-winning, best-selling technical books, full-length video courses, and O'Reilly Conference videos, visit the ACM Learning Center and click on the Safari Learning Platform in the right hand corner. Please visit our Safari FAQ to learn more about the new Safari platform.

Featured ScienceDirect Title: Coding for Penetration Testers
Coding for Penetration Testers discusses the use of various scripting languages in penetration testing. The book presents step-by-step instructions on how to build customized penetration testing tools using Perl, Ruby, Python, and other languages. It also provides a primer on scripting including, but not limited to, Web scripting, scanner scripting, and exploitation scripting.

This is just one of nearly 1,200 titles from publishers Morgan Kaufmann (MK) and Syngress in ACM's eBook collection, covering the most bleeding-edge topics in computing, such as Big Data, Cybersecurity, Human-Computer Interaction, Parallel Computing, and more. The books are available in PDF (and some in ePub) and are downloadable to your desktop, laptop, tablet, and any popular eBook reader on your mobile device. All members (Student and Professional) can access them through the ScienceDirect portal on the ACM Learning Center as well as the ACM Digita Library.

ACM Interview: Juergen Schmidhuber
Tune in as the leaders, innovators, and entrepreneurs advancing computing as a science and a profession discuss their background, experience, and career highlights, all while providing invaluable insights and lessons learned for future computing professionals in this ongoing series of exclusive interviews conducted by Stephen Ibaraki, Co-Chair of the ACM Practitioners Board.

In a recent ACM Podcast Stephen Ibaraki interviewed Juergen Schmidhuber, Co-director of the Dalle Molle Institute for Artificial Intelligence Research. The Deep Learning Neural Networks developed since the early 1990s in Prof. J�rgen Schmidhuber's group at TU Munich and the Swiss AI Lab IDSIA (USI and SUPSI) have revolutionized machine learning and AI, and are now available to billions of users through Google, Apple, Microsoft, IBM, Baidu, and many other companies. His research group also established the field of mathematically rigorous universal AI and optimal universal problem solvers. His formal theory of creativity and curiosity and fun explains art, science, music, and humor. He is the recipient of numerous awards including the 2016 IEEE Neural Networks Pioneer Award, and is President of NNAISENSE, which aims at building the first practical general purpose AI.

NEWS/ANNOUNCEMENTS

Volunteer Your Computing Skills for a Social Good with ACM and SocialCoder
You can use your technical skills for social good and offer volunteer support on software development projects to organizations who could not otherwise afford it. SocialCoder connects volunteer programmers/software developers with registered charities and helps match them to suitable projects based on their skills, experience, and the causes they care about. Learn more about ACM's new partnership with SocialCoder, and how you can get involved.

to view image click on

Association for
Computing Machinery

2 Penn Plaza, Suite 701, New York, NY 10121

Copyright © 2017, ACM, Inc. All rights reserved



You are subscribed with: &EMAIL;
Unsubscribe

Connect with us:


to view image click on to view image click on to view image click on to view image click on
to view image click on to view image click on to view image click on to view image click on